Join our team as a skilled Endace Platform Engineer, where you will play a pivotal role in architecting, deploying, integrating, and operating Endace packet capture, monitoring, and network recording solutions across a vast, distributed enterprise environment. The ideal candidate will possess extensive expertise in network forensics, packet analytics, and telemetry architecture, along with practical experience in supporting Zero Trust visibility and segmentation strategies.
Your responsibilities will encompass the complete lifecycle management of Endace systems, including design, installation, configuration, maintenance, and long-term optimization. You will ensure seamless integration of the platform with SIEM/SOAR, detection engineering, analytics tools, and broader Zero Trust security measures.
Key responsibilities include leading the design, deployment, and setup of Endace appliances for enterprise-level packet capture, developing packet capture strategies aligned with network architecture and mission requirements, and building high-availability, scalable Endace clusters across data centers and cloud environments. You will also integrate Endace with various analytics ecosystems such as SIEM, SOAR, NDR, EDR, and threat intelligence platforms. Your role will involve maintaining and optimizing Endace hardware and software for peak performance, addressing issues related to packet loss and performance bottlenecks, and monitoring device health to ensure forensically sound data capture. Additionally, you will manage PCAP retention strategies and align Endace visibility architecture with Zero Trust telemetry requirements, supporting the development of traffic baselines and enforcement models using Endace data. Automation of deployment and sustainment workflows using Ansible or Terraform will also be a part of your responsibilities. You will collaborate with network engineering, cloud teams, and security operations to guarantee comprehensive telemetry coverage, and provide training and guidance on best practices for Endace platform usage.
